Transaction 549151d5a0b879a8c5cc2cec74eb8531176b0b0cbd5e0fdbb978e8040424482c
1 Input
1 Outputs
- 549151d5a0b879a8c5cc2cec74eb8531176b0b0cbd5e0fdbb978e8040424482c:0
value 307392
address 13yfvRaqqCH2cTUpDe6wLfHewmcaxVNHrt